| Commit message (Expand) | Author | Age | Files | Lines |
* | net: dsa: mv88e6xxx: move driver in its own folder | Vivien Didelot | 2016-06-25 | 1 | -3953/+0 |
* | net: dsa: mv88e6xxx: abstract switch registers accesses | Vivien Didelot | 2016-06-21 | 1 | -59/+145 |
* | net: dsa: mv88e6xxx: add port base address to info | Vivien Didelot | 2016-06-21 | 1 | -1/+18 |
* | net: dsa: mv88e6xxx: pass compatible info | Vivien Didelot | 2016-06-21 | 1 | -1/+16 |
* | net: dsa: mv88e6xxx: add detection helper | Vivien Didelot | 2016-06-21 | 1 | -34/+30 |
* | net: dsa: mv88e6xxx: add SMI init helper | Vivien Didelot | 2016-06-21 | 1 | -5/+21 |
* | net: dsa: mv88e6xxx: add chip allocation helper | Vivien Didelot | 2016-06-21 | 1 | -12/+27 |
* | net: dsa: mv88e6xxx: rename smi_mutex to reg_lock | Vivien Didelot | 2016-06-21 | 1 | -60/+60 |
* | net: dsa: mv88e6xxx: remove table args in info lookup | Vivien Didelot | 2016-06-21 | 1 | -10/+6 |
* | net: dsa: mv88e6xxx: use gpio get optional variant | Vivien Didelot | 2016-06-21 | 1 | -10/+3 |
* | net: dsa: mv88e6xxx: add switch register helpers | Vivien Didelot | 2016-06-21 | 1 | -13/+28 |
* | net: dsa: mv88e6xxx: do not increment bus refcount | Vivien Didelot | 2016-06-21 | 1 | -3/+0 |
* | net: dsa: mv88e6xxx: use already declared variables | Vivien Didelot | 2016-06-21 | 1 | -3/+3 |
* | net: dsa: mv88e6xxx: remove redundant assignments | Vivien Didelot | 2016-06-21 | 1 | -3/+0 |
* | net: dsa: mv88e6xxx: fix style issues | Vivien Didelot | 2016-06-21 | 1 | -19/+23 |
* | net: dsa: Add new binding implementation | Andrew Lunn | 2016-06-04 | 1 | -0/+7 |
* | net: dsa: mv88e6xxx: Refactor MDIO so driver registers mdio bus | Andrew Lunn | 2016-06-04 | 1 | -9/+80 |
* | net: dsa: mv88e6xxx: Rename _phy_ to _mdio_ | Andrew Lunn | 2016-06-04 | 1 | -63/+63 |
* | net: dsa: mv88e6xxx: Only support EDSA tagging | Andrew Lunn | 2016-06-04 | 1 | -6/+2 |
* | net: dsa: Copy the routing table into the switch structure | Andrew Lunn | 2016-06-04 | 1 | -2/+2 |
* | net: dsa: Remove dynamic allocate of routing table | Andrew Lunn | 2016-06-04 | 1 | -2/+1 |
* | net: dsa: Add a ports structure and use it in the switch structure | Andrew Lunn | 2016-06-04 | 1 | -11/+16 |
* | net: dsa: mv88e6xxx: fix circular lock in PPU work | Vivien Didelot | 2016-06-04 | 1 | -4/+9 |
* | net: dsa: mv88e6xxx: remove bridge work | Vivien Didelot | 2016-05-16 | 1 | -29/+8 |
* | dsa: mv88e6xxx: Handle eeprom-length property | Andrew Lunn | 2016-05-12 | 1 | -0/+17 |
* | dsa: Rename switch chip data to cd | Andrew Lunn | 2016-05-12 | 1 | -2/+2 |
* | dsa: Remove master_dev from switch structure | Andrew Lunn | 2016-05-12 | 1 | -0/+1 |
* | dsa: Move gpio reset into switch driver | Andrew Lunn | 2016-05-12 | 1 | -1/+13 |
* | dsa: Add mdio device support to Marvell switches | Andrew Lunn | 2016-05-12 | 1 | -18/+72 |
* | dsa: mv88e6xxx: Rename probe function to fit the normal pattern | Andrew Lunn | 2016-05-12 | 1 | -4/+4 |
* | dsa: mv88e6xxx: Initialise the mutex as soon as it is created | Andrew Lunn | 2016-05-12 | 1 | -2/+1 |
* | net: dsa: mv88e6xxx: add STU capability | Vivien Didelot | 2016-05-12 | 1 | -12/+2 |
* | net: dsa: mv88e6xxx: abstract VTU/STU data access | Vivien Didelot | 2016-05-12 | 1 | -4/+28 |
* | net: dsa: mv88e6xxx: factorize the switch driver | Vivien Didelot | 2016-05-09 | 1 | -83/+271 |
* | net: dsa: mv88e6xxx: factorize switch setup | Vivien Didelot | 2016-05-09 | 1 | -36/+33 |
* | net: dsa: mv88e6xxx: factorize GLOBAL_CONTROL_2 setup | Vivien Didelot | 2016-05-09 | 1 | -0/+7 |
* | net: dsa: mv88e6xxx: factorize GLOBAL_MONITOR_CONTROL setup | Vivien Didelot | 2016-05-09 | 1 | -0/+12 |
* | net: dsa: mv88e6xxx: factorize GLOBAL_CONTROL setup | Vivien Didelot | 2016-05-09 | 1 | -0/+13 |
* | net: dsa: mv88e6xxx: factorize global setup | Vivien Didelot | 2016-05-09 | 1 | -53/+56 |
* | net: dsa: mv88e6xxx: factorize switch reset | Vivien Didelot | 2016-05-09 | 1 | -66/+71 |
* | net: dsa: mv88e6xxx: factorize ATU access | Vivien Didelot | 2016-05-09 | 1 | -0/+14 |
* | net: dsa: mv88e6xxx: factorize VTU access | Vivien Didelot | 2016-05-09 | 1 | -0/+16 |
* | net: dsa: mv88e6xxx: factorize bridge support | Vivien Didelot | 2016-05-09 | 1 | -0/+9 |
* | net: dsa: mv88e6131: add registers access | Vivien Didelot | 2016-05-09 | 1 | -1/+5 |
* | net: dsa: mv88e6xxx: factorize EEE access | Vivien Didelot | 2016-05-09 | 1 | -0/+6 |
* | net: dsa: mv88e6xxx: factorize MAC address setting | Vivien Didelot | 2016-05-09 | 1 | -2/+12 |
* | net: dsa: mv88e6xxx: factorize temperature access | Vivien Didelot | 2016-05-09 | 1 | -3/+6 |
* | net: dsa: mv88e6xxx: factorize EEPROM access | Vivien Didelot | 2016-05-09 | 1 | -2/+214 |
* | net: dsa: mv88e6xxx: factorize PHY indirect access | Vivien Didelot | 2016-05-09 | 1 | -33/+4 |
* | net: dsa: mv88e6xxx: factorize PHY access with PPU | Vivien Didelot | 2016-05-09 | 1 | -15/+25 |